Happy Valley Indian Restaurant - Puerto Rico Shopping Center

Discussion in 'Puerto Rico Bars & Restaurants' started by Gran Canaria Blog, Aug 28, 2012.

  1. Happy Valley Indian Restaurant is located on the top floor of Puerto Rico Shopping Center, near to Star Club Dancing and Black and White Piano bar. We have heard of guests returning numerous times in the same holiday to this restaurant. Have you tried it out? What did you think?

Share This Page